Finished Far Cry:Blood Dragon (PS3) this afternoon. It's a game I've been wanting to play for a while and thanks to PS+ I got it as part of this months offerings.

 

The game is genuinely hilarious. It's very aware of itself and constantly pokes jokes at video games and movies. The 80s action and sci-fi references are fantastic and constantly had me chuckling away to myself. Michael Biehn does a fantastic job of adding to the 80s feel and hams up his lines quite nicely. Doing the Rambo screaming while firing a mini gun = cheesy grin from me.

 

Special mention has to go to the soundtrack. Again, it's sooooo 80s action flick and there's certain themes that play that could easily have been ripped out of any one of Arnie or Slys films.

 

Finally, the final section of the game had me in stitches. If you're a fan of Rocky IV and aren't too bothered about seeing the mission then give this a watch. :D

I decided to play Grow Home, after @Fierce_LiNk told me to give it a try. I finished it today, but I can't say I really enjoyed it much. The controls just feel too loose and ropy, making your character move in every direction but the one you want him to actually move into. I cursed so many times as BUD fell off a platform as I was trying to maneuver around it, or as he fell of a vine I was trying to climb cause the camera wasn't aligned with his movement...

 

The game started out ok but it soon got pretty boring/tedious, just climbing up (falling a million times in the process) and collecting the odd bits. Not even sure why exactly I was doing what I was doing, I think I must have missed some part of the intro that explained it.

 

I didn't hate the game, but to be honest, I was glad I finished it. And decided I wouldn't bother collecting all the other things I missed. :P

Anyway, looks like I'll be updating my diary again after all, as the credits rolled on Just Cause 3 yesterday! :awesome:

 

What an entertaining game, and easily the best sandbox title I've ever played. The amount of stuff you can do by combining all of Rico's tools is just incredible. icon14.gif

 

It's also a game that pushes the PS4 to its limit! Once you start getting creative (i.e. silly) with the chaos, it's pretty much destroying the console!

For example, I filled a truck up with about a dozen bodies + other random stuff :heh: but with so many physics based objects in a confined space the frame rate took such a huge hit! Literally single figures per second it looked like! :D

I'm amazed the engine even allows for that. You'd expect some objects to vanish over time, but it seems like there's no limitations in place! :o

 

Anyway, I fully liberated the map before finishing the story, but still got quite a few collectibles to obtain and challenges left to do, not to mention just messing around with the citizens of Medici some more. :grin:

Just a shame there's no option to change the appearance of Rico, as I'm not a fan of how they made him look like Diego Costa in this version. :laughing:
